Remove Enterprise Suite fake antispyware

Entreprise Suite GUI screenshotEnterprise Suite is another reason why the internet is currently quite a dangerous place to go. Enterprise Suite is a fake antivirus program, a follower of the previously known Windows Enterprise Suite. The distribution of Enterprise Suite is being deployed through dirty means which involve the use of counterfeit online ads – fake scanners mostly. Enterprise Suite enters your system as a multitude of trojan viruses that stream inside via exploits and other security vulnerabilities of the to-be compromised computer system. Once Enterprise Suite lands down onto your PC, it configures your system to run ‘clsv.exe’ and ‘wsd4c.exe’ executables so that the rogue program gets launched each time you boot into Windows. Consequently, you will have to encounter Enterprise Suite scanners and all kinds of its nagging ads including pop-ups and system tray alerts. This adware aims to produce the false impression that your computer is at risk and needs a remedy. Then, Enterprise Suite suggests you its services to help your system resist the purported infections. In fact, though, Enterprise Suite won’t be able to clean your system because it’s not fit to. Enterprise Suite only tries to rip you off – so much for its activity. Besides, it slows down and can even ruin your system so you’d better remove Enterprise Suite immediately after it gets spotted.

Enterprise Suite behavior on the infected PC:

If your system is contaminated with rogue anti-spyware, you are likely to encounter the following symptoms:

  • Enterprise Suite slows down your computer and causes occasional PC freezes
  • Enterprise Suite hijacks the homepage and redirects the web-browser to its affiliated malicious websites
  • Enterprise Suite decreases the internet connection speed
  • Enterprise Suite displays annoying fake alerts
  • Enterprise Suite may install a rootkit or trojan in your system

How to remove Enterprise Suite from your PC:

If you have good technical skills you can try to get rid of Enterprise Suite manually. Enterprise Suite manual removal presupposes finding and deleting its files and registry entries; but before that, make sure you back up all important data to prevent its possible loss in case any unpredictable technical issues occur during the procedure.

Remove Enterprise Suite files and folders:

%Documents and Settings%\All Users\Application Data\345d567
%Documents and Settings%\All Users\Application Data\345d567\752.mof
%Documents and Settings%\All Users\Application Data\345d567\mozcrt19.dll
%Documents and Settings%\All Users\Application Data\345d567\sqlite3.dll
%Documents and Settings%\All Users\Application Data\345d567\WE345d.exe
%Documents and Settings%\All Users\Application Data\345d567\WES.ico
%Documents and Settings%\All Users\Application Data\345d567\WESSys
%Documents and Settings%\All Users\Application Data\345d567\WESSys\vd952342.bd
%Documents and Settings%\All Users\Application Data\WESSys
%Documents and Settings%\All Users\Application Data\WESSys\wes.cfg
%UserProfile%\Application Data\Enterprise Suite
%UserProfile%\Application Data\Enterprise Suite\cookies.sqlite
%UserProfile%\Application Data\Enterprise Suite\Instructions.ini
%UserProfile%\Application Data\Microsoft\Internet Explorer\Quick Launch\Enterprise Suite.lnk
%UserProfile%\Desktop\Enterprise Suite.lnk
%UserProfile%\Recent\ANTIGEN.dll
%UserProfile%\Recent\cb.exe
%UserProfile%\Recent\cid.dll
%UserProfile%\Recent\CLSV.tmp
%UserProfile%\Recent\DBOLE.sys
%UserProfile%\Recent\ddv.sys
%UserProfile%\Recent\eb.exe
%UserProfile%\Recent\energy.sys
%UserProfile%\Recent\exec.tmp
%UserProfile%\Recent\FS.exe
%UserProfile%\Recent\grid.drv
%UserProfile%\Recent\runddlkey.drv
%UserProfile%\Recent\sld.drv
%UserProfile%\Recent\SM.drv
%UserProfile%\Recent\tempdoc.dll
%UserProfile%\Recent\tempdoc.tmp
%UserProfile%\Recent\tjd.sys
%UserProfile%\Start Menu\Enterprise Suite.lnk
%UserProfile%\Start Menu\Programs\Enterprise Suite.lnk
%Program Files%\Mozilla Firefox\searchplugins\search.xml

Remove Enterprise Suite registry entries:

H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\3
HKEY_CLASSES_ROOT\CLSID\{3F2BBC05-40DF-11D2-9455-00104BC936FF}
HKEY_CLASSES_ROOT\WE345d.DocHostUIHandler
H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Classes\Software\Microsoft\Internet Explorer\SearchScopes “URL” = “http://search-gala.com/?&uid=162&q={searchTerms}”
H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Internet Explorer\Download “RunInvalidSignatures” = “1″
H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Internet Settings\5.0\User Agent\Post Platform “[xSP_2:117fc3395e69e29f71abba93a68c4181_162]“
H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Internet Settings\5.0\User Agent\Post Platform “887805703″
HKEY_CLASSES_ROOT\Software\Microsoft\Internet Explorer\SearchScopes “URL” = “http://search-gala.com/?&uid=162&q={searchTerms}”
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Run “Enterprise Suite”
